  • Publication number: 20250112973
    Abstract: Various embodiments of the present technology generally relate to systems and methods for routing messages for 4G and 5G sessions. In certain embodiments, a Policy and Charging Rules Function (PCRF) system may comprise one or more processors, and a memory having stored thereon instructions. The instructions, upon execution, may cause the one or more processors to receive a 4G communication session initiation request for a 4G session, and in response to the 4G communication session initiation request, issue a session binding request directed to a Binding Support Function (BSF), the session binding request directing the BSF to create a binding record linking the 4G session to the PCRF to enable routing of Application Function (AF) messages to the PCRF via the BSF. The instructions may further cause the one or more processors to receive an AF message routed to the PCRF based on the binding record.

  • Patent number: 12238523
    Abstract: Various embodiments of the present technology generally relate to systems and methods for efficiently cleaning up resources within a network by bundling binding session audit requests. A binding support function (BSF) may determine support for bundled audit requests and unbundled audit requests at one or more policy control functions (PCFs) associated with potentially stale session binding records at the BSF. Based on audit support function at the PCF, the BSF may determine whether to bundle audit requests together, issue unbundled audit requests, or not issue any audit requests. PCF support for bundled or unbundled auditing may be provided via a network repository function (NRF), via headers in binding creation or update requests, or both.

  • Publication number: 20240365102
    Abstract: Various embodiments of the present technology generally relate to systems and methods for controlling data network name (DNN) or access point name (APN) replacement for roaming mobile subscribers at the home network. A security edge protection proxy (SEPP) system may receive a request from a visited network regarding a roaming user equipment (UE) associated with a home network of the SEPP system, determine a local data network name (DNN) compatible with the home network to associate with the UE, add the local DNN to the request, and forward the request to a destination within the home network.

  • Patent number: 11638134
    Abstract: Methods, systems, and computer readable media for resource cleanup in communications networks are disclosed. One method for resource cleanup in a communications network comprises: at a policy control function (PCF) comprising at least one processor: receiving, from a binding support function (BSF), a first notification indicating a potentially stale or inactive first binding record, wherein the first notification includes context data associated with the first binding record; determining that resource cleanup associated with the first binding record should be performed; and initiating, using the context data, resource cleanup associated with the first binding record at one or more network entities.
